The night at Sambisa Forest…

Shey kin shi?” Mr Kanayo still sang despite he had already began his search.

No sound. Not even the wind. It was like the children disappeared.

He walked around and held onto the stick in his hand, ready to use it on his first target.

He saw a pair of long legs hanging from the top of a tree in a distance.

His first target.

He dashed for the leg and pulled it all the way down until Lawal’s whole body found itself on the ground.

Lawal groaned in pain while Mr Kanayo came to stand in front of him with the stick pointing to his face.

“Mr K,” Lawal looked at him in confusion, “What are you doing?”

“Something I should have done long ago.” Mr Kanayo replied.

He began rubbing Lawal’s body in all the wrong places with the stick, causing Lawal to shudder in fear.

Lawal tried to hold the stick to stop him but Mr Kanayo began poking him with it. Poking him harder and harder on all the wrong places, causing him to wince in pain.

Lawal begged him to stop but this caused him to poke him faster and faster until it felt like he was stabbing him with the stick.

“This is what you do to the girls, abi?” Mr Kanayo poked him harder, mostly focusing on his private parts, “You think you can touch them without their consent, enh?”

“Sir, I don’t understand-”

“I’ve seen what you do to the girls in your class. You think girls are your playground, abi?”

“It’s just a joke, sir!”

“A joke, enh?” Mr Kanayo became more furious at this statement and poked him harder. “And Mariam, nko?”

“It was a stupid kiss! I was just playing the game!”

Mr Kanayo stopped poking and looked up in frustration, “It‘s just a kiss today, until it turns to torn clothes tomorrow.”

He looked down at Lawal with dark eyes. Lawal stared back at his eyes, becoming frightened at how scary and desperate they looked.

“Sir-”

“Die!” Mr Kanayo rose the stick and slammed his head with it. Soon, it turned to a violent beating, “Die! Die! The world does not need more predators like you.”

Mr Kanayo beat Lawal with the stick until Lawal stopped moving. By the time Mr Kanayo stopped, he found blood all over his red suit and face.

He looked down at a lifeless Lawal’s body and threw the stick at him without feeling any remorse.

The world does not need any more of you, Mr Kanayo thought to himself.

Soon, his dark eyes began to get more fury. It was then he realized that the game has truly begun.

One down, ten more to go.

And that was how Mr Kanayo began his mission; punishing all the pupils in his class for their sins.

He believed he was Karma incarnate.

According to him, If you don’t get rid of the weed while it’s young, it will grow and destroy the whole farm.

And to him, this world was his whole farm.

As he was wiping off the blood stains on his suit, he stumbled upon some old skeletons on the ground.

They were dead cattle’s skeletons that had been eaten by maggots years ago. He reached down for the most fascinating part of the skeleton; the skull.

He picked up the cow’s skull and wiped out dirt from it before placing the skull over his face like a face mask.

He smiled beneath that cow’s skull and looked up to the moon.

“Tonight, we take out the weed one by one, Baba (father).”

One by one, he caught the kids in their hiding place.

One by one, he tortured each of them for their sins.

He was merciless.

He was brutal.

He was more deadly than any predator in the forest.

Stabbed pretty boy Zafar in the face multiple times, because vanity always led to damnation.

Burnt angry Biodun in his hiding place inside an abandoned car because uncontrolled anger was like a little spark that could cause a wild fire someday.

Fed maggots to obese Precious until she could no longer feel her tongue exist.

Dared Hassan and Husseini to climb up a tall tree to look for their stupid Nintendo DS until they fell from it and died flat on the ground, because Pokémon would never come to their rescue.

And for the grand finale... Amina the merciless bully.
